Hypoxia is known to impact DNA repair mechanisms. The primary aim of this study was to examine the impact of chronic (5 days) hypoxia on the expression of DNA repair genes in glioblastoma and medulloblastoma cell lines. The NanoString nCounter VantageTM RNA Panel for DNA Damage and Repair (LBL-10250-03) was utilised to analyse gene expression using total RNA extracted from cells. 4 glioblastoma and 2 medulloblastoma cell lines incubated in 21% 1% or 0.1% O2 for 5 days. Gene expression was compared to cells incubated at 21% (control). Experiments were performed in triplicate.
